Educators worldwide are increasingly recognizing the importance of implementing authentic assessment methods in education to enhance student learning outcomes. Authentic assessment goes beyond traditional tests and quizzes, focusing on real-world applications and practical skills that students can apply in their future careers.
According to a recent study by the National Education Association, 89% of teachers believe that authentic assessment methods have a positive impact on student engagement and motivation. By incorporating real-world tasks, projects, and performance-based assessments, educators can better evaluate students' critical thinking, problem-solving, and communication skills.

Authentic assessment methods not only benefit students but also align with the demands of the modern workforce. Employers are increasingly seeking graduates who possess practical skills and can apply their knowledge in real-world scenarios. By implementing authentic assessment methods, educators can better prepare students for success in their future careers.
Furthermore, research shows that 76% of students prefer authentic assessments over traditional tests. By engaging students in hands-on projects, presentations, and simulations, educators can create a more dynamic and interactive learning environment that fosters creativity and innovation.
